Transaction 7069ba74fcd5ea59dc57ad8f08b0101fdb2567b05d3c0bd277a96fe2c0157523
1 Input
2 Outputs
- 7069ba74fcd5ea59dc57ad8f08b0101fdb2567b05d3c0bd277a96fe2c0157523:0
- 7069ba74fcd5ea59dc57ad8f08b0101fdb2567b05d3c0bd277a96fe2c0157523:1
value 294398640
address 1BEcWgEkaanRduyAvuSvhzCoLh8yrRjmqF
value 9702307
address 18dsaC6dKpE38nrA2xhF9kmaMJqouS1aYV